Output 102e393d321613a5857737c171a0a9f9dd3ec0db16f58b201874492873c5f0b8:1

value
989852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0efdc9ac37612fa595694d649e83c145d91ad518 OP_EQUAL
address
334HQiMKFtQxfuZPW7g6HJcFYPoPd3VoiW
transaction
102e393d321613a5857737c171a0a9f9dd3ec0db16f58b201874492873c5f0b8
confirmations
312583
spent
true